About this property
Property Description:
25 Eastbourne Road is a charming mid-terrace property located in the vibrant and well-connected Warbreck Park area of Liverpool. This traditional home offers comfortable living space ideal for families or first-time buyers. The property is typically arranged with two or three bedrooms, a spacious through lounge, a kitchen, and a bathroom. Externally, there is a small rear yard providing some outdoor space.
Area Details:
The property is situated in the L9 0JE postcode area, which is well-served by local amenities and offers easy access to transportation links, making it a great choice for commuters and families alike.
Transportation:
Aintree Station (0.4 miles): Provides quick access to Liverpool city center and beyond.
Orrell Park Station (0.6 miles) and Fazakerley Station (0.7 miles): Both are within easy reach, offering additional connectivity to the region.
Local Amenities:
Supermarkets: The area boasts a range of supermarkets such as Aldi, Asda, Farmfoods, Iceland, Lidl, M&S Simply Food, Sainsbury's, and Tesco, offering plenty of shopping options for everyday needs.
Schools:
Longmoor Community Primary School is just 0.2 miles away, ideal for families with young children.
Archbishop Beck Catholic College (0.5 miles) provides further educational options.
Healthcare:
Aintree University Hospital is nearby, making healthcare services readily accessible for residents.
Parks and Green Spaces:
The property is close to various parks and green spaces, providing opportunities for outdoor activities, walking, and relaxation.
Overall, the location of 25 Eastbourne Road offers a balanced mix of suburban tranquility and urban convenience, with excellent transport links, local schools, shopping, and recreational options.
